HISTORY ASPECTS:
The B-25B Mitchell U.S. Army was a medium bomber aircraft used by the United States during World War II. One of the most famous missions of the B-25B was the Doolittle Raid on Tokyo in 1942, which was a critical turning point in the war. The B-25B was also used in the North African and Mediterranean campaigns, as well as the Pacific theater.
The "Hari Kari-er" was a B-25B Mitchell that was flown by Captain Charles Ross Greening during the Doolittle Raid. The plane was ran out of fuel leaving the raid and had to crash land in China. The crew was forced to abandon the plane and were eventually rescued by Chinese guerilla forces.
